Common Issues and Errors Related to ifl0.dll
D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.
- Cannot register ifl0.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.
- Ifl0.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
- The file ifl0.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
- This application failed to start because ifl0.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
- Ifl0.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the Ifl0.dll Errors
In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to ifl0.dll by utilizing the (DISM) tool.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ealthand press Enter. -
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ifl0.dll Error
In this guide, we will fix ifl0.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annowand press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
